1. Leader/Line Connections
1. Improved Clinch Knot – Secures fly to tippet.
2. Palomar Knot – Strong, simple knot for hooks/lures.
3. Uni Knot (Duncan Loop) – Versatile for flies/swivels.
4. Orvis Knot – Low-profile, strong for small flies.
5. Turle Knot – Classic for wet flies.
2. Line-to-Line Knots
6. Blood Knot – Joins similar-diameter tippets.
7. Double Surgeon’s Knot – Quick leader-to-tippet connection.
8. Albright Knot – Connects dissimilar diameters (e.g., fly line to backing).
9. Nail Knot – Attaches leader to fly line.
10. Loop-to-Loop – Fast leader/line changes.
3. Loop Knots (for Movement)
11. Non-Slip Mono Loop – Secure loop for streamers.
12. Perfection Loop – Clean loop for leader butt sections.
13. Surgeon’s Loop – Easy heavy-duty loop.
4. Tippet Extensions
14. Triple Surgeon’s Knot – Stronger tippet-to-leader join.
15. Seaguar Knot – Fluorocarbon-friendly.
5. Dropper Rigs
16. Dropper Loop – Adds a tagline for multiple flies.
17. Blood Knot Dropper – Integrated dropper off main line.
